The construction of the Perm State District Power Station (PERMSKAYA GRES) began in 1976. Over 20 design organizations and research institutes took part in working out the detail design of the station. The latest technical solutions were used during the construction and assembly operations. Installed at the station were unique systems of controlling technological processes, developed by ABB (Germany) and Energiko (Finland).
The design capacity of PERMSKAYA GRES was 4,800 megawatts, and its installed capacity - 2,400 megawatts. Built and put into operation in 1986, 1987 and 1990 were three 800-megawatt power units. The station burns gas for fuel.
In 1993 the enterprise became an open joint-stock company founded by RAO "EES Rossii". Since it went into operation PERMSKAYA GRES has produced 112,000 million kilowatts of electricity. At times its annual output reached 14,000 million kilowatt-hours. The station produces and delivers electricity to the federal (all-Russian) wholesale electric power market; the thermal energy it produces is delivered to consumers in the town of Dobryanka.
Financial matters are handled for the company by the joint-stock commercial bank "Transkapitalbank" and Sberbank of the Russian Federation. PERMSKAYA GRES has its representative offices in Perm, Moscow, Chelyabinsk and Vyatka, and is the founder of the Trade House "PermGRES IMEX". In the future it is planned to complete the construction of Power Unit No.4. A search for major investors is still going on. It is also planned to prepare technical solutions for the use of "zero-level construction sites" for building Power Units No.5 and No.6.
